Gemini 2.0 Flash-Lite leads with 4.0% higher average benchmark score. Gemini 2.0 Flash-Lite offers 800.8K more tokens in context window than Llama 3.1 405B Instruct. Gemini 2.0 Flash-Lite is $1.41 cheaper per million tokens. Gemini 2.0 Flash-Lite supports multimodal inputs. Llama 3.1 405B Instruct is available on 8 providers. Gemini 2.0 Flash Lite was created as an even more efficient variant of Gemini 2.0 Flash, designed for applications where minimal latency and maximum cost-effectiveness are essential. Built to bring next-generation multimodal capabilities to resource-constrained deployments, it optimizes for speed and affordability.

Llama 3.1 405B was developed as Meta's largest open-source language model, designed to provide frontier-level capabilities with 405 billion parameters. Built to demonstrate that open-source models can match proprietary systems in capability, it enables researchers and developers to experiment with and deploy a powerful foundation model without licensing restrictions.
